According to Adam Smith, what happens when the supply of a product decreases?
BARSIC [14]

<span>The mechanism establishing natural price by Adam Smith connects with effective demand and free competition. If you cut the supply of goods, the demand for them is higher. Because of this, there competition between buyers. Afraid not get the right product, they agree to buy it at a higher cost. The market price will rise. When supply and demand are roughly equal, the market value corresponds to approximately natural.</span>

Chief sitting bull led the coalition of plains tribes against the us seventh cavalry unit and defeated them at June 1876 conflic
Harrizon [31]
The conflict was known as Little Big Horn
The battles was held between the army Lakota, Northern Cheyenne, and Indian tribes versus the 7th Cavalry Regiment of the United States led by Custer.
Due to the overwhelming loss that experienced by the United States side, this battle was alson known as <span>Custer's Last Stand</span>
